关于iOS13新特性问题,持续更新中...

最新刚把电脑的系统和Xcode升级到最新,以前编译的项目重新编译突然发现有问题了。

iOS13深浅模式,由于以前应用大部分页面背景颜色都默认色,这次运行一看,app一片黑,一脸懵逼,然后查看了下,发现自己手机设置的是深色模式。由于时间紧迫,找到了一个全局设置浅色模式的方法。

在Info.plist文件里,多加两行这样的代码即可。

UIUserInterfaceStyle

Light

设置完成全局变成浅色了,其他运行基本正常,但是底部菜单按钮的文字切换会还原成默认的蓝色

解决方案:

给UITabbar -> Bar Tint 设置颜色,什么颜色都可以。



目前临时发现这些,欢迎大家探讨。

你可能感兴趣的:(关于iOS13新特性问题,持续更新中...)